Message type: E = Error
Message class: /BDL/TASKMANAGER -
Message number: 010
Message text: Service Definitions have been deleted &

/BDL/TASKMANAGER010 Service Definitions have been deleted
typically indicates that there is an issue with the service definitions in the Business Data Layer (BDL) of SAP. This can occur in various scenarios, particularly when working with SAP Business Workflow or SAP Business Process Management (BPM).Cause:
Deletion of Service Definitions: The error suggests that the service definitions required for the task manager to function properly have been deleted or are missing. This could happen due to:
- Manual deletion of service definitions.
- System upgrades or migrations that did not complete successfully.
- Inconsistent data in the database.
Transport Issues: If service definitions were transported from one system to another (e.g., from development to production), and the transport did not include all necessary objects, this error may occur.
Configuration Issues: Incorrect configuration settings in the BDL or related components can lead to this error.
Solution:
Check Service Definitions: Verify if the required service definitions exist in the system. You can do this by navigating to the relevant transaction codes or using the BDL administration tools.
Restore Deleted Definitions: If service definitions were deleted, you may need to restore them from a backup or re-create them manually if possible.
Transport Requests: If the issue arose after a transport, check the transport logs to ensure that all necessary objects were included. You may need to re-transport the missing definitions.
System Consistency Check: Run consistency checks in the BDL to identify and rectify any inconsistencies in the service definitions.
Reconfigure BDL: If configuration issues are suspected, review the BDL configuration settings and ensure they are set up correctly.
Consult S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ates available that resolve the issue.
Contact SAP Support: If the problem persists after trying the above solutions, consider reaching out to SAP Support for further assistance.
